System Availability: 1 # System items in: 1 # Local items: 1 # Local items in: 1 Current Holds: 0 Place Request Add to My List Expand All | Collapse All Availability Large Cover Image Summary Students gain an understanding of the causes of World War I and the reasons for American intervention. Primary source documents describe the U.S. preparation for war, life in the trenches, the experience of African-American soliders, and post-war struggles and conflict over the Fourteen Points. Also presented are several historians' interpretations of the war. Librarian's View Syndetics Unbound Displaying 1 of 1
